迴轉式自動鏟花裝置
國立虎尾科技大學
2013/07/21
本發明係關於一種迴轉式自動鏟花裝置,設有一驅動組、一連桿組與一刀具組,該驅動組設有一結合架、一驅動馬達及一凸輪塊,該驅動馬達固設於該結合架內,該凸輪塊設於該結合架一側且設有一抵靠面,該連桿組與該驅動組相結合且設有一主框架、一上連桿、一下連桿、一連接桿及一滾輪,該主框架與該驅動馬達相結合,兩連桿係與該主框架及該連接桿相樞設結合,該滾輪可轉動地設於該上連桿上且與該抵靠面相貼靠,該刀具組與該連桿組相結合且設有一刀具架與一鏟刀,藉以提供一方便組裝使用、加工精度高且可自動鏟花的迴轉式自動鏟花裝置者。 an automatic measuring and scraping system is presented. The system is composed of a triangulation laser, an automatic scraping mechanism and a 3-axis moving stage, and is used for fast measuring and automatic scraping of the workpiece. A triangulation laser is setup on the Z-axis of 3-axis moving stage, and is utilized to measure the depth of the scraping workpiece. The developed on LabVIEW tool is used to setup moving path and detecting area, and is used to measure the variation of the scraping surface. The whole scraped profile can be scanned of depth about 5 to 20 μm under 100 mm/s moving velocity and provide the specific measuring parameters. In terms of automatic scraping, the scraping area and moving path are generated by the developed tool, and are used to operate the automatic scraping system to achieve the automatic scraping.
